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ЭКЗАМЕНАЦИОННЫЙ БИЛЕТ.docx
Скачиваний:
4
Добавлен:
01.04.2025
Размер:
83.57 Кб
Скачать

2. Проблемы организации коммуникаций по сети.

При проектировании коммуникационной сети должны быть решены следующие основные проблемы:

* Именование и разрешение имен. Как два процесса найдут друг друга для коммуникации?

* Стратегии маршрутизации (routing). Каким образом сообщения посылаются по сети?

* Стратегии соединения (connection). Каким образом два процесса обмениваются сообщениями?

* Разрешение конфликтов. Сеть – разделяемый ресурс; каким образом разрешаются конфликтующие запросы на ее использование?

3. Архивирование данных.

Архивация данных — это помещение одного или нескольких файлов, или папок с файлами, в один файл, в котором все эти файлы и папки в сжатом виде хранятся. Этот файл называется архивом или архивным файлом.

ЭКЗАМЕНАЦИОННЫЙ БИЛЕТ №19

1. Реализация файловых систем.

Реализация системы файлов имеет иерархическую структуру, на верхнем уровне которой – пользовательские программы, на нижнем – драйверы и устройства ввода-вывода.

2. Типы сетей.

С точки зрения размещения, сети подразделяются на локальные – сети, размещаемые в одной или нескольких комнатах или зданиях – и глобальные – сети, объединяющие географически удаленные друг от друга машины.

3. Настройка основных параметров ОС Windows.

ЭКЗАМЕНАЦИОННЫЙ БИЛЕТ №20

1. Виртуальные файловые системы.

Виртуальные файловые системы (VFS) обеспечивают объектно-ориентированный способ реализации файловых систем.

VFS обеспечивает единый интерфейс системных вызовов (API) для различных типов файловых систем, которые могут быть очень разными по своей реализации, включая сетевые файловые системы.

Данный API является набором операций над самой VFS, а не над каким-либо специфическим типом файловых систем.

Схема организации виртуальной файловой системы изображена на рис. 20.1.

2. Сетевые топологии.

Машины могут быть соединены в сеть различными способами (проводные сети и беспроводные сети различных стандартов) и с использованием различных топологий: полностью соединенная сеть, частично соединенная сеть, сеть древовидной структуры, сеть с топологией "звезда", сеть с топологией "кольцо".

3. Установка операционной системы Linux.

ЭКЗАМЕНАЦИОННЫЙ БИЛЕТ №21

1. Файловые системы, основанные на расширениях.

Многие современные файловые системы, - например, Veritas File System, или Vx-FS – основная файловая система в ОС HP-UX фирмы Hewlett-Packard, - используют модифицированное смежное размещение файлов. Дисковые блоки в такой системе размещаются в расширениях (extents). Расширение – это смежный блок на диске. Файл состоит из одного или нескольких расширений. Таким образом, если длина файла не увеличивается, он хранится в виде одной смежной области внешней памяти, что обеспечивает максимальную эффективность доступа. В случае увеличения длины файл представляется списком из основной части и расширений.

2. Сетевые и распределенные системы.

Сетевые системы могут быть одноранговыми или клиент-серверными.

В распределенной системе (distributed system)вычисления распределены между несколькими физическими процессорами (компьютерами), объединенными между собой в сеть.

Слабо связанная система (loosely coupled system) – распределенная компьютерная система, в которой каждый процессор имеет свою локальную память, а различные процессоры взаимодействуют между собой через линии связи – высокоскоростные шины, телефонные линии, беспроводную связь (Wi-Fi, EVDO, Wi-Max и др.).

Преимущества распределенных систем:

1. Разделение (совместное использование) ресурсов: в распределенной системе различные ресурсы могут храниться на разных компьютерах. Нет необходимости дублировать программы или данные, храня их копии на нескольких компьютерах.

2. Совместная загрузка (load sharing): каждому компьютеру в распределенной системе может быть поручено определенное задание, которое он выполняет параллельно с выполнением другими компьютерами своих заданий.

3. Надежность: при отказе или сбое одного из компьютеров распределенной системы его задание может быть перераспределено другому компьютеру, чтобы сбой в минимальной степени повлиял или вовсе не повлиял на итоговый результат.

4. Связь: в распределенной системе все компьютеры связаны друг с другом, так что, например, при необходимости возможен удаленный вход с одного компьютера на другой с целью использования ресурсов более мощного компьютера.